Розглянемо основні методи використання порожніх значень в умовах запитів 1С 8.3.
Перевірка на NULL
виконується за допомогою конструкції Є NULL, наприклад:
ВИБРАТИ
ВнутренніеЗаказиОстаткі.Заказчік,
ВнутренніеЗаказиОстаткі.КолічествоОстаток
З
РегістрНакопленія.ВнутренніеЗакази.Остаткі ЯК ВнутренніеЗаказиОстаткі
ДЕ
ВнутренніеЗаказиОстаткі.КолічествоОстаток Є NULL
Порожня дата в запиті 1С
Порожня дата в запиті встановлюється конструкцією ДАТАВРЕМЯ (1, 1, 1, 0, 0, 0), приклад:
Перевірка на порожній рядок в запиті 1С
В умовах для знаходження порожнього рядка необхідно використовувати порожнє значення рядка - «», наприклад:
Марія, звідки Ви взяли такий синтаксис?
Давайте подивимося детальніше встановлювати параметри і порожні значення:
НЕ ПРАВИЛЬНО
//|РемонтнийЛістМатеріалиЗамена.ДатаРемонта>= Значення ( "ДатаНач")
ПРАВИЛЬНО
//|РемонтнийЛістМатеріалиЗамена.ДатаРемонта>= # 038; ДатаНач
Де «Водії» ім'я довідника, тип якого має реквізит «Водітель3» (можливо співробітники або фізичні особи)
Синтаксис неправильний так як я струму вчуся :) спасибо большое. але водій це реквізит не довідника а документа. чи має це значення?
а ще підкажіть будь ласка як ось на підставі цього ж запиту заповнити осередки в звіті на перетині водія і дати необхідно поставити колво годин скільки він був в ремонті